Macaulay Culkin reprises his role as Kevin McCallister in Home Instead’s “Home But Not Alone” campaign.
The campaign aims to highlight the importance of in-home care for older adults, promoting independence and dignity.
The ads include references to the original 'Home Alone' movie, blending nostalgia with a message about senior care.
Jody Hill, director of 'The Righteous Gemstones', directed the campaign, bringing humor and heart to the topic.
Why this matters:: This campaign uses a familiar and beloved character to address a growing need for senior care, sparking conversations about how to support aging parents and loved ones.
The “Home But Not Alone” campaign features Culkin as an adult Kevin McCallister, now concerned about the safety of his mother. The ads depict Kevin taking measures to protect her from potential household dangers, such as installing stairlifts and securing carpets. One ad features a nod to Old Man Marley from 'Home Alone', with Kevin interacting with Marley's granddaughter, who advises him to talk to his mother about getting help. The campaign includes several spots, such as 'Granddaughter Marley', 'Groceries', 'Your Turn', and 'The Delivery'. These ads will air during showings of 'Home Alone' and other holiday programming through January 11, encouraging families to consider in-home care options. The campaign builds upon Home Instead’s “A Better What’s Next” initiative, emphasizing the positive impact of staying safely at home for aging parents.
